What Is Car Window Tinting?
Car window tinting is the process of applying a thin, transparent film to your vehicle’s glass surfaces. These films are engineered to reduce glare, block harmful UV rays, regulate cabin temperature, and enhance privacy - all while adding a stylish finish to your car.
While DIY tint kits exist, the quality, precision, and durability of professional tinting services far exceed anything you can achieve at home. Professional technicians use top-grade films, precise cutting tools, and clean-room techniques to guarantee a flawless application.
Why Get Your Car Windows Tinted in Newcastle?
If you live or drive around Newcastle, you know how intense the sun can be, especially during summer. Prolonged sun exposure not only makes driving uncomfortable but also damages your car’s interior over time. That’s why car window tinting in Newcastle NSW is such a smart investment.
Here are the top benefits:
1. UV Protection and Interior Preservation
High-quality tint films block up to 99% of harmful UV rays, helping to protect your skin and reduce fading or cracking in your upholstery and dashboard.
2. Enhanced Comfort and Temperature Control
Tinting keeps your car cooler by minimizing heat build-up. This reduces the need for constant air conditioning - improving energy efficiency and comfort during long drives.
3. Increased Privacy and Security
Window tinting adds a layer of privacy by making it harder for outsiders to see inside your car. It also strengthens your windows, making them less likely to shatter in case of impact or break-ins.
4. Improved Aesthetics
A well-tinted car looks sleek, modern, and stylish. You can choose from a range of shades and finishes that complement your vehicle’s design.

The Professional Tinting Process: What to Expect
If it’s your first time getting your car windows tinted, you might wonder what actually happens during the process. Here’s what a professional window tinting service in Newcastle typically includes:
1. Consultation and Film Selection
Your tinting technician will start by discussing your goals - whether it’s UV protection, privacy, glare reduction, or aesthetics. Based on this, they’ll recommend the best film options that comply with NSW tinting laws.
Modern tint films include:
- Dyed film - Budget-friendly, good for aesthetics.
- Metalized film - Excellent heat and glare reduction.
- Ceramic film - Premium option offering superior UV and heat rejection without signal interference.

2. Surface Preparation
Before applying the film, the technician thoroughly cleans all windows to remove dust, oils, and contaminants. This ensures the film adheres perfectly and no bubbles form beneath the surface.
3. Film Cutting and Application
Professionals use computer-cutting technology or precise hand-cutting techniques to shape the film to your car’s exact window measurements. The film is then carefully applied using a specialized solution to prevent creases or air pockets.
4. Drying and Curing Time
After application, your vehicle will need time for the film to dry and bond properly. This can take anywhere from 24 hours to a few days, depending on humidity and temperature. During this period, avoid rolling down your windows.
5. Quality Inspection
Before handing your car back, the technician inspects the tint job to ensure it’s even, smooth, and compliant with NSW tint laws.
Choosing the Right Tint Shade and Film
Not all tint films are created equal. When selecting your tint, consider factors like appearance, performance, and legal limits.
In New South Wales, the law requires:
- Front side windows: Must have at least 35% visible light transmission (VLT).
- Rear windows: Can be darker, but must still allow for clear vision.
- Windscreen tinting: Limited to a small strip at the top (the “sun visor strip”).
Ceramic films are a popular choice among Newcastle drivers for their heat-blocking efficiency, optical clarity, and durability - without interfering with GPS or mobile signals.

How Long Does Car Window Tinting Take?
On average, professional tinting takes about 1.5 to 3 hours, depending on the size of your vehicle and the number of windows being tinted. SUVs or vans may take a bit longer.
After installation, you should wait at least 48 - 72 hours before rolling down your windows to allow the adhesive to cure fully.
How to Care for Your New Window Tint
Proper maintenance ensures your tint lasts for years without fading or peeling. Follow these simple tips:
- Wait before cleaning: Avoid washing the inside of your windows for at least a week after tinting.
- Use gentle cleaners: Choose ammonia-free window cleaners and a soft microfiber cloth.
- Avoid sharp objects: Be cautious when loading or unloading items that might scratch the film.
- Park in shaded areas: This minimizes UV exposure and extends tint life.
With good care, quality tint films can last 5 to 10 years - sometimes even longer.
Cost of Car Window Tinting in Newcastle
The price of car window tinting in Newcastle NSW depends on several factors, including:
- Vehicle type (sedan, SUV, ute, etc.)
- Number of windows
- Tint film quality and brand
- Additional features like UV or infrared protection
On average, professional tinting can range from $250 to $600, but investing in high-quality film is always worth it for the long-term comfort and protection it offers.
